Seek medical attention. If you find yourself injured, see a doctor as soon as possible. In addition to being good health advice, you will need the doctor's diagnosis and paperwork from your visit as evidence. Make sure you document everything, and keep copies for yourself. Failing to get medical attention after an accident or injury can actually reduce the award amount in a personal injury case.

Look for a lawyer willing to work on a contingency basis. This means that your lawyer will not get paid unless you receive a settlement. Not only will this mean your lawyer has a vested interest in getting you a good settlement, it also means you won't be left with a large legal fee should your case be dismissed.

The more paperwork you have, the better. Keep diagnosis records and referral requests from doctors. Keep a log of money lost thanks to missing work. Keep receipts for everything from your doctor's bills to medical necessities like bandages, wheelchairs or splints. Keep a journal about everything that happens from accident to end judgement, too.

If you are unhappy with your personal injury attorney, know that you can terminate the contract. This must be done in writing, but it gives you an out and allows you to find someone else to represent you. Just keep in mind that if you choose to do this, you will still owe your attorney funds for the work he has completed prior to being let go.
